logo

Output a66e7be8d0237eddd2b6ef2ee79b206d930aacadf10bfd5c61c80d10aa61624a:1

value
18572853229
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 89094a839561d8907136260fc7c84c53cd01eca4 OP_EQUALVERIFY OP_CHECKSIG
address
1DVahqU8GkxmnujZwAAHkdfQwK4JRGVsSs
transaction
a66e7be8d0237eddd2b6ef2ee79b206d930aacadf10bfd5c61c80d10aa61624a